Colburn, Green Bay, WI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Colburn?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Colburn Studio Apartments | $1,354 | $1,150 | $1,600 |
| Colburn 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,346 | $570 | $1,985 |
| Colburn 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,864 | $680 | $3,850 |
| Colburn 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,325 | $790 | $3,775 |

Cheapest Available Colburn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Colburn area of Green Bay, WI is a 1 Bed unit found at Moraine Court priced from $750. Western Ave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$775. Here are the most affordable Colburn apartments for rent in Green Bay, WI: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Moraine Court | 1 Bed Apartment | 1BR,1BA | $750 |
| Western Ave Apartments | 1 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$775 |
| Mesa Adobe | 1 Bed 1 Bath - 1340 | 1BR,1BA | $849 |
| 1760 Badger Street | 1760 Badger Street - 10 | 1BR,1BA | $850 |
| 1184 Western Avenue | 1184 Western Avenue - 209 | 1BR,1BA | $850 |
| Villa West | 1 Bedroom 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$864 |
| Velp Avenue Apartments | Floor Plan A | 2BR,1BA | $875 |
| Garden Bay Square | 2 bed / 1 bath | 2BR,1BA | $995 |
| 1530-1550 Moraine Ter | 2 Bed/1 Bath | 2BR,1BA | $999 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Colburn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Colburn?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Colburn is under $999.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Colburn?
The cheapest apartment in Colburn is Moraine Court which is listed at $750, while the average apartment in Colburn costs $2,424.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Colburn?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 2 regular apartments in Colburn that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Colburn?
Cheap apartments in Colburn have an average cost of $315 which is $2,109 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Colburn.
